According to the forums post, you have to create a script in /etc/acpi/resume.d 
to restart powernowd (that sets your cpu power config to default, ondemand in 
both cores in my case). Further instructions in the link in my previous comment.
If you want to manually change your cpu speed you can use cpufreq-selector.
